即通过jsp把数据库的查询记录放到excel中去.
请高手帮忙.

解决方案 »

  1.   

    Asp的参考下:
    http://expert.csdn.net/Expert/topic/2301/2301258.xml?temp=.356106    dim i,j,k
        On Error Resume Next
    set objExcelApp = CreateObject("Excel.Application") 
    objExcelApp.DisplayAlerts = false
    objExcelApp.Application.Visible = false
    objExcelApp.Workbooks.Open("e:\web\jianzhu\shengchan.xls") '打开Excel模板 
    set objExcelBook = objExcelApp.ActiveWorkBook 
    set objExcelSheets = objExcelBook.Worksheets 
    set objExcelSheet = objExcelBook.Sheets(1) 
        i=1
        for each x in rs.fields
    objExcelSheet.cells(5,i).value= x.name
    i=i+1
        next
             k=1
         j=5
    while not rs.eof
       for each x in rs.fields
         objExcelSheet.cells(j+1,k).value=x.value
          k=k+1
       next
       k=1
     rs.movenext
     j=j+1
    wend
    objExcelBook.Save
    objExcelApp.Quit
    set objExceApp=Nothing
    set rs=nothing  
    rs.Close 在我机子上运行成功!
    也希望你能成功!
    呵呵
      

  2.   

    利用JAVA操作EXCEL文件http://www-900.ibm.com/developerWorks/cn/java/l-javaExcel/index.shtml请参考,一定行的,我已经实现:word用jacob,excel用jxl
    1、http://www-900.ibm.com/developerWorks/cn/xml/tips/x-tipword/index.shtml
    2、http://www-900.ibm.com/developerWorks/cn/java/l-java-tips/index.shtml
    3、http://www-900.ibm.com/developerWorks/cn/java/l-javaExcel/index.shtmlhttp://www.andykhan.com/jexcelapi/http://expert.csdn.net/Expert/topic/2168/2168595.xml?temp=6.618679E-03